    摘要:

    在室内水培条件下, 研究了吲哚丁酸(IBA)、插条类型及插条留叶方式对野生蔬菜少花龙葵(Solanum photeinocarpum)插条生根的影响。结果表明, 5~35 mg L-1 IBA处理的少花龙葵半叶嫩枝插条生根率均为100%, 以20 mg L-1 IBA处理的平均生根数最多。促进少花龙葵半叶硬枝插条生根的IBA浓度为15~35 mg L-1,其中以25 mg L-1 IBA的效果最好。少花龙葵嫩枝和硬枝插条分别在20与25 mg L-1 IBA处理下,均以半叶插条的生根效果最好、缺叶插条的生根效果最差,全叶插条的生根效果居中。

    Abstract:

    The effects of IBA and different cutting types, retaining leaves ways on cutting propagation of wild vegetable Solanum photeinocarpum cultured in water were studied. The results showed that the rooting from shoot with half leaf was 100% treated with 5~35 mg L-1 IBA, but the average of rooting was the highest treated with 20 mg L-1 IBA. The rooting from hardwoods with half leaf could be promoted treated with 15~35 mg L-1 IBA, which it had the best effect treated with 35 mg L-1 IBA. The softwoods and hardwoods treated with 20 and 25 mg L-1 IBA, respectively, the rooting effects was in order of segments with half leaf > whole leaf > without leaf.
